Drakewood Farm is an all-inclusive wedding venue that sits on 40 beautiful acres of rolling farmland. Our most popular wedding location is our wooded ceremony area. Our 170-year-old barn is perfect for weddings, as well as country music videos, especially when the light comes streaming in just right. Our 6,000 square foot reception pavilion can be open-air or heated and cooled as needed for the comfort of your guests. All of ceremony and reception spots can be custom decorated to make your perfect backdrop to say "I Do!" Our property also feature a 1850s historic mansion and a rustic loft above our stone cottage for getting ready. To make wedding planning fun and easy we include personalized event styling, wedding coordinators to handle every detail of your day, D.J., bartenders, beautiful in-house floral design, custom catering, amazing cakes, and our vintage china and glasses for a fully set table.

How Much Do Tennessee Wedding Venues Cost?

The average Tennessee wedding venue costs $7,110 which is significantly more affordable than many other popular wedding destinations. You'll typically find prices ranging from $6,390 to $7,810 compared to the national range that runs $6,500-$12,000. This means your dollar stretches further while still securing a memorable location.

For different guest counts expect these average total wedding costs: small weddings with 50 guests run about $18,652 while medium-sized celebrations with 100 guests average $31,008. Larger gatherings with 150 guests typically cost $42,626 and 200-guest weddings average $53,014. The most expansive celebrations with 250 guests come in around $63,402 while truly large weddings with 300 guests average $73,790. Your specific vision and venue choice will obviously influence these figures.

When Should You Book Your Tennessee Venue?

Most Tennessee couples book their venues 10 months ahead; about 318 days before the big day. You'll want to note that October sees the highest number of wedding inquiries which reveals strong demand for fall ceremonies. This timing makes perfect sense since Tennessee's autumn foliage creates spectacular natural backdrops with rich reds oranges and yellows that can transform even simple venues into magical settings. Planning ahead is especially important if you're dreaming of a fall wedding.

What's the Breakdown of Tennessee Wedding Costs?

Venue costs represent about 17% of your total wedding budget in Tennessee. You'll allocate your remaining budget across several key services that complete your celebration. Catering runs about $5,688 (13%) while florists average $5,276 (12%) and bar services typically cost $4,550 (11%). Photography averages $3,982 (9%) with videographers at $3,555 (8%) and wedding planners around $3,128 (7%). Entertainment from bands or DJs averages $1,390 (3%) while cakes and desserts run about $655 (2%) and hair and makeup services average $390 (1%).
